Job Description

Our client is seeking a Transportation Lead to provide strategic and technical leadership on complex transportation infrastructure initiatives across municipal and regional systems within Calgary or Edmonton, AB.

This is a senior-level role suited to a trusted advisor who can guide clients through planning, analysis, and design while delivering practical, forward-looking solutions. The successful candidate will lead multidisciplinary projects, mentor technical teams, and play a key role in business development and the continued growth of the transportation practice

Responsibilities:

Technical Leadership & Project Delivery

  • Lead complex, multi-disciplinary transportation programs and major infrastructure projects

  • Oversee planning, analysis, and design of transportation systems, including:

    • Roadways, streetscapes, and complete streets

    • Interchanges, intersections (arterial, freeway, expressway), signals, and roundabouts

    • Traffic calming, safety, and mobility improvements

    • Active transportation and transit infrastructure

    • Parking studies and access management

  • Prepare and review engineering reports, design drawings, specifications, and cost estimates

  • Ensure all work aligns with municipal, provincial, and national standards and guidelines

  • Act as Project Manager, Technical Lead, or Subject Matter Expert as required

  • Manage project scope, schedule, budget, and overall performance

Collaboration & Stakeholder Engagement

  • Work closely with internal teams across civil engineering, land development, geomatics, and landscape architecture

  • Coordinate subconsultants and engage with stakeholders, regulatory bodies, and the public

  • Represent the organization in meetings with clients, municipalities, and agencies

Business Development & Practice Growth

  • Build and maintain strong client relationships within municipalities and government agencies

  • Lead proposal development, including scope definition, scheduling, and fee estimation

  • Develop win strategies and provide technical leadership on pursuits

  • Identify and pursue new opportunities to support long-term growth of the transportation practice

  • Contribute to market presence through industry engagement and networking

Team Leadership & Mentorship

  • Mentor and support junior and intermediate staff

  • Provide technical oversight and contribute to a high-performance team culture

  • Lead quality control and technical review processes

  • Support continuous improvement of tools, processes, and best practices

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Engineering

  • Professional Engineer (P.Eng.) designation (or equivalent), registered or eligible with APEGA

  • 10–15 years of transportation engineering experience, preferably within a consulting environment

  • Strong technical expertise in:

    • Transportation planning, design, and operational analysis

    • Urban design and mobility planning

    • Municipal, provincial, and national design standards

  • Experience with transportation modeling and analysis tools such as Synchro, SIDRA, VISUM, HCS, and AutoTURN

  • Proficiency with AutoCAD and Civil 3D (preferred)

  • Experience with TORUS, ARCADY, and/or Rodel (asset)

  • Working knowledge of ArcGIS (asset)

  • Proven project management capabilities, including experience with PM tools and methodologies

  •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ities

  • Demonstrated success in client relationship management and stakeholder engagement

  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, including presenting technical information to diverse audiences

  • Experience leading and contributing to proposal development

  • Valid driver’s license and willingness to travel as required

  • Ability to pass a background check
